I've been following the news about Melbourne University's takeover of the Victorian College of the Arts. Even Geoffrey Rush has stepped in. From the ABC news:
'Oscar winning actor, Geoffrey Rush joined the chorus of voices railing against the planned integration of performance and fine arts courses into the so-called Melbourne Model, led by Melbourne University.
Opponents say the changes would force students to take more generalised, theoretical subjects and would reduce their ability to specialise.'
I'm not sure if that's true or what the implications will be, but I know there are many people who see it as a bad thing.
